On Saturday, Zuzana Čaputová took up her post as Slovakia's president as the first woman to do so in the country's history. Prime Minister Peter Pellegrini said he was looking forward to cooperating with her. Speaker of Parliament Andrej Danko expressed the wish that she might help people to find the truth, to preserve the national identity and humanity. Danko also delayed the moment of swearing the presidential oath by giving a speech instead of just opening the Parliamentary session. According to the constitution, this act is supposed to take place at noon; however, it came seven minutes later. Former Prime Minister and chair of the largest governing SMER-SD party Robert Fico did not attend the ceremony.
